Saturday night's Penn State White Out, featuring a roaring crowd of 110,830, epitomized college football's unmatched atmosphere.
In a thrilling showdown, the No. 7 Nittany Lions commanded the field, blanking No. 24/22 Iowa with a resounding 31-0 victory.
